1.

Let x1=97,x_1=97, and for n>1n\gt1 let xn=nxn1.x_n=\frac{n}{x_{n-1}}. Calculate the product x1x2x8.x_1x_2\cdots x_8.

Answer: 384
Concepts:recursionalgebraic manipulation
Difficulty rating: 1610
Small Hint:

Multiply consecutive terms using the recurrence

Big Hint:

Group the requested product as (x1x2)(x3x4)(x5x6)(x7x8)(x_1x_2)(x_3x_4)(x_5x_6)(x_7x_8)

Solution:

The recurrence gives xn1xn=n.x_{n-1}x_n=n. Therefore x1x2x8=(x1x2)(x3x4)(x5x6)(x7x8)=2468=384. \begin{aligned} x_1x_2\cdots x_8 &=(x_1x_2)(x_3x_4)\\ &\quad{}\cdot(x_5x_6)(x_7x_8)\\ &=2\cdot4\cdot6\cdot8\\ &=384. \end{aligned}
